Relic Entertainment just revealed Company of Heroes 3: Final Stand, a standalone experience to get strategy fans right into the action.

They said the point of it is to capture the strategy and intensity of Company of Heroes battles but in a more fast-paced wave defense experience for solo and cooperative play. Sounds similar mechanically to Dawn of War II – The Last Stand.

From the press release sent to GamingOnLinux: “Built on the beloved tactical foundation of Company of Heroes, Final Stand expands the series’ signature combat with roguelite progression that encourages experimentation, adaptation, and replayability. Players must dig in, build layered defenses, and survive against escalating waves of enemy forces across 12 increasingly challenging rounds, featuring intimidating bosses and dynamic battlefield events unique to Final Stand. Final Stand will launch at $29.99 USD/£23.99 GBP/€28.99 EUR on July 29. Players can take advantage of a 10% launch period discount, while Company of Heroes 3 owners will receive an additional 20% bundle discount.”

Game Highlights:

  • All-new standalone Company of Heroes wave defense experience.
  • Single-player and cooperative gameplay.
  • Command four iconic factions: US Forces, Wehrmacht, British Forces, or Deutsches Afrikakorps.
  • Roguelite progression and persistent upgrades present new strategic possibilities in every run.
  • 36 boss units with special abilities and rewards.
  • 18 dynamic in-game events.
  • 8 difficulty levels from newcomer to veteran.
  • 5 battlegrounds designed for wave defense gameplay.
  • Survive 12 escalating waves, or take on Endless Mode for the ultimate challenge.
  • Faction-specific progression trees with impactful upgrades.
  • Unlock 4 premium cosmetic skin packs (1 per faction).
  • Brand-new Announcer VO performances bring your Final Stand to life.
